The membership year runs from the 1st April to 31st March.
Joining fee (One off for new members) - £30
Membership per person - £125 for up to 12 months from 1st April 2023 until 31st March 2024
There is no charge for children (under 18) but they must be accompanied by a responsible adult member with a sensible adult to child ratio.

Complete a membership application online. You will be sent an e-welcome pack, and we will be in touch to arrange to meet you at the club, and give you a key.. Payment is by electronic bank transfer. We will provide details when you send your membership form.
We can give you some basic tuition to get you afloat in either rowing boats, kayaks and paddle boards or you can go out sailing initially as crew in our sailing boats. Once you can demonstrate basic competency with particular boats you are “signed-off” for those boats and can then use them without supervision.
We do not require formal boating qualifications but professional training including: RYA dinghy levels 1,2,3 . British Canoeing kayak rolling and foundation safety, RYA Powerboat Level 2, and RYA Day skipper are available to members at special discounted rates through our partnerships with Woodmill, SWAC, and other local clubs.
